    Donald told Roker Report: “We’re talking about strengthening the team with two or three more signings before the window shuts.

    "A couple of players on the desk are probably going to cost us half a million pounds if we decide they are the ones to go for.”

    The Sunderland owner added: “We’re not far away on one and that one may extend to three but it might end up being two.

    “If you asked me now, I would hope we will sign a couple of players next week but I would certainly expect there to be one. They’re defensive players.”
